Transaction 2bf31e43522abe4cf4e0b5d8c42692755a78578190c4d34ffda54bb80ec526b9
1 Input
1 Output
-
2bf31e43522abe4cf4e0b5d8c42692755a78578190c4d34ffda54bb80ec526b9:0
- value
- 105280
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1fb7e321816a0e48eba8f0d449d4087ceb54a16c OP_EQUAL
- address
- 34ajACWTUY3ZLycBUX8zZyMjBsmb9FPt5m